The below products may be vehicle-specific. Add your vehicle to shop what fits.

The below products may be vehicle-specific.

Add your vehicle to shop what fits.

The below products may be vehicle-specific.

Add your vehicle to shop what fits.

Shop By Vehicle

The below products may be vehicle-specific. Add your vehicle to shop what fits.

The below products may be vehicle-specific.

Add your vehicle to shop what fits.

The below products may be vehicle-specific.

Add your vehicle to shop what fits.

Shop Pistons & Parts

Pistons & Parts

Filter & sort by
876 Results
Sort by
Filter by
Sorted by Recommended For You
  • Product image is missing! Special Order

    ACL

    Part No. C1672-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B1910-.25
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 6B2390-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B2956-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B8380-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L

    Part No. RB4068
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L DURAGLIDE

    Part No. 4B2741-020
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B603H-020
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L DURAGLIDE

    Part No. 4B2510-.25
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 6B2380H-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L DURAGLIDE

    Part No. 4B1685-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B8411H-.25
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B2322H-.25
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B8360-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 6B2390H-.25
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B1146H-.25
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L DURAGLIDE

    Part No. 8B2106-030
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B8341-.75
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B2746-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 6B8350-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L

    Part No. 4B2166-1.00
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B1060H-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B8240-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B1185-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 6B2630HX-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B1171-.75
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B8285-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B1185H-.025
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B8036H-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 6B7971-020
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B1171-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B2166H-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 6B1180-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B2821-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B2636-020
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L

    Part No. RB4101
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B2960HX-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 8B634H-009
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B8366H-.25
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 6B2630-.25
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 6B1180-.50
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B8366-.25
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B8210A-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L RACE SERIES

    Part No. 4B1630H-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L DURAGLIDE

    Part No. 8B2356-010
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B8036A-STD
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    NDC

    Part No. 4B1851-.25
    Sign in for Trade Prices
    (0)
  • Product image is missing! Special Order

    ACL DURAGLIDE

    Part No. 6B2420-STD
    Sign in for Trade Prices
    (0)